Job Description

Position Summary

The Administrative Support Specialist provides day-to-day support to the Communications, Compliance & Finished Goods Department through financial record-keeping, reporting, invoice entry, inventory documentation, and administrative functions. This position also assists with operational and regulatory records related to the Company’s distilling and bottling activities.

The ideal candidate is organized, detail-oriented, dependable, and comfortable working with financial records and multiple systems. This position works closely with Accounting and Distribution Operations and may assist with additional responsibilities as business needs arise.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Enter and itemize invoices in QuickBooks.
  • Complete assigned accounting reports and records.
  • Complete daily, monthly, shipping, and other assigned operations reports.
  • Maintain assigned TTB-related records and documentation.
  • Maintain receiving, bottling, and basic barrel inventory records.
  • Close completed orders in the applicable system.
  • Maintain organized files and records, including annual record retention.
  • Order office supplies.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, etc.).
  • Demonstrate a welcoming, professional presence in all guest/coworker interactions, including customer service duties and occasional phone support, with an emphasis on hospitality and representing the organization positively.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or a related field preferred.
  • Relevant accounting experience may be considered in lieu of a degree.
  • QuickBooks experience preferred.
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to learn and follow established accounting and regulatory processes.
